An intelligent lawn mower includes a cutting blade for cutting grass, a deck for supporting the cutting blade, at least one wheel rotatably supporting the deck, a first drive motor to provide torque to the at least one wheel, a mowing path generation module to set multiple target positions on a first virtual boundary and a second virtual boundary of a mowable area boundary according to a preset path and generate a mowing path from the target positions, and a controller electrically connected to or communicated with a display interface and the mowing path generation module to control the intelligent lawn mower to perform mowing tasks along the mowing path generated by the mowing path generation module.